By Steven T. Karris
This article contains the subsequent chapters and appendices: universal quantity platforms and Conversions, Operations in Binary, Octal, and Hexadecimal platforms, signal value and Floating aspect mathematics, Binary Codes, basics of Boolean Algebra, Minterms and Maxterms, Combinational common sense Circuits, Sequential good judgment Circuits, reminiscence units, complicated mathematics and common sense Operations, creation to box Programmable units, advent to the ABEL Description Language, advent to VHDL, creation to Verilog, and advent to Boundary-Scan structure. every one bankruptcy comprises quite a few functional functions. it is a design-oriented textual content. for more information. please stopover at the Orchard guides website.
Read or Download Digital Circuit Analysis and Design with Simulink Modeling and Introduction to CPLDs and FPGAs PDF
Similar science & technology books
Arithmetic lecturers and faculty library media experts will locate this ebook a helpful source for utilizing the internet to advertise severe considering within the highschool arithmetic lecture room. it truly is choked with tutorial suggestions and an expansive set of actions that disguise a vast array of arithmetic subject matters spanning from prealgebra via calculus.
Alexander Graham Bell's request for his assistant to 'come right here' revolutionized the way in which America's electorate communicated with each other. This publication appears to be like on the invention of the phone and its integration into society.
Positive factors why Google purposes are the simplest loose on-line studying instruments to be had at the present time. themes contain how scholars and educators can collaborate with Google files, how the types program permits academics to create instant-feedback quizzes, and the way a literature classification can take lit journeys with Google Maps.
Technological know-how schooling needs to be enhanced so that it will turn into extra aware of the desires of society faced with a swiftly altering global. Bringing technology educating as much as the next point is a key consider this endeavour. The authors of this ebook take into consideration academics as a part of the instant and massive groups and platforms during which they functionality.
- Allies and enemies : how the world depends on bacteria
- Urban Nightscapes: Youth Cultures, Pleasure Spaces and Corporate Power (Critical Geographies)
- Great Scientists (Eyewitness Guides)
- Chemistry: Matter and Change Challenge Problems
- A CLASSIFICATION OF LIVING ANIMALS
Additional resources for Digital Circuit Analysis and Design with Simulink Modeling and Introduction to CPLDs and FPGAs
If S = 1 , E = 255 , and F = 0 , then Value = – ∞ . In other words, 000000000000000000000 S E F Value = – Infinity ⎧ ⎨ ⎩ 0 or 1 ⎧ ⎪ ⎨ ⎪ ⎩ 11111111 ⎧ ⎪ ⎪ ⎪ ⎪ ⎨ ⎪ ⎪ ⎪ ⎪ ⎩ 5. If S = 0 or S = 1 , E = 255 , and F ≠ 0 , then Value = NaN *. In other words, 001001110000000000000 S E F Value = NaN 6. 2) is used, it is understood, although not shown, that the mantissa (fraction) is prefixed with an implicit leading 1 followed by the binary point. 101 ) 2 * NaN = Not a Number . It occurs in certain operations such as 0 ⁄ 0 , ∞ ⁄ ∞ , etc.
Using this definition prove that subtraction can be performed if we add the twos−complement of the subtrahend to the minuend. 9 Solutions to End−of−Chapter Exercises 1. 1 Carries 110010010 ⎫ ⎬+ 1011100 ⎭ 111101110 Check: ( 110010010 ) 2 = ( 402 ) 10 ( 1011100 ) 2 = ( 92 ) 10 Then, ( 111101110 ) 2 = ( 402 + 92 ) 10 = ( 494 ) 10 2. 11 11111 111111 Carries 110110 ⎫ 101001 ⎪ ⎪ 100111 ⎬ + ⎪ 11010 ⎪ 111101 ⎭ 11011101 Check: ( 110110 ) 2 = ( 54 ) 10 ( 101001 ) 2 = ( 41 ) 10 ( 100111 ) 2 = ( 39 ) 10 ( 11010 ) 2 = ( 26 ) 10 ( 111101 ) 2 = ( 61 ) 10 Then, ( 11001110 ) 2 = ( 54 + 41 + 39 + 26 + 34 ) 10 = ( 221 ) 10 2−18 Digital Circuit Analysis and Design with Simulink ® Modeling and Introduction to CPLDs and FPGAs, Second Edition Copyright © Orchard Publications Solutions to End−of−Chapter Exercises 3.
0f \t',v);... 0f \t',z); fprintf(' \n') x=270 y=101 v=169 z=169 5. E743 ⎫ ⎬+ F9C8 ⎭ 1E10B Check with MATLAB: x=base2dec('E743',16); y=base2dec('F9C8',16); z=base2dec('1E10B',16); v=x+y;... fprintf(' \n');... 0f \t',v);... 0f \t',z); fprintf(' \n') x= 59203 y= 63944 v=123147 z=123147 Digital Circuit Analysis and Design with Simulink ® Modeling and Introduction to CPLDs and FPGAs, Second Edition Copyright © Orchard Publications 2−19 Chapter 2 Operations in Binary, Octal, and Hexadecimal Systems 6.